J S S Polytechnic for Women, Mysore
Established in 1980, J S S Polytechnic for Women in Mysore stands as an important institution dedicated to the technical education and empowerment of women in the Mysuru district of Karnataka. With a campus spanning 40 acres, it provides a conducive environment for focused learning and skill development.
The institute operates under a private aided management, ensuring a blend of autonomous decision-making with government support. It specializes as a technical polytechnic, catering specifically to women, which makes it a notable choice for those looking to pursue technical diploma courses in a focused and supportive setting.
